{"product_id":"2940172641947","title":"Raising the Flag: How a Photograph Gave a Nation Hope in Wartime","description":"\u003cp\u003eBy February 1945 the United States had been fighting World War II for more than three years. Soldiers were worn down from battle, and civilians were drained by sacrifice. But a photograph of Marines raising an American flag on Japanese soil gave a wearied nation a renewed sense of pride and hope. This powerful image of strength and determination became the most famous image of the war. It not only captured a moment of victory against a strong foe. It also represented the effort every member of the armed forces had made and offered Americans the promise of victory and an end to conflict.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Capstone Press","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":47100378022128,"sku":"2940172641947","price":5.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0737\/7593\/9824\/files\/2940172641947_p0.jpg?v=1772803500","url":"https:\/\/shop-qa.barnesandnoble.com\/products\/2940172641947","provider":"Barnes \u0026 Noble (DEV)","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
